learn moreBall Mill an overview | ScienceDirect Topics
The ball mill is a tumbling mill that uses steel balls as the grinding media. The length of the cylindrical shell is usually 1– times the shell diameter (Figure ).The feed can be dry, with less than 3% moisture to minimize ball coating, or slurry containing 20–40% water by weight.
learn moreDefinition of circulating load
Definition of circulating load. i. In mineral processing, use of a closed circuit to check mineral issuing from a specific treatment and to return to the head of the treatment those particles that do not satisfy the maintained conditions for release to the next stage of treatment. Ref: Pryor, 3 ii. In ore dressing, oversize material returned to a ball mill for further grinding. Ref: Newton, 1 ...

Common Basic Formulas for Mineral Processing Calculations. The term circulating load is defined as the tonnage of sand that returns to the ball mill, and the circulating load ratio is the ratio of circulating load to the tonnage of original feed to the ball mill. learn moreTHE OPTIMAL BALL DIAMETER IN A MILL
The ball impact energy on grain is proportional to the ball diameter to the third power: 3 E K 1 d b. (3) The coefficient of proportionality K 1 directly depends on the mill diameter, ball mill loading, milling rate and the type of grinding (wet/dry). None of the characteristics of the material being ground have any influence on K 1.
